XGrids Lixel CyberColor + PortalCam: The World Isn’t Flat, and Now Your Camera Knows It

3D Gaussian Splatting sounds like something a physics PhD invented to win an argument at a dinner party, but it has quietly become one of the most consequential breakthroughs in spatial computing in years. The short version: rather than building a 3D scene out of polygons the way traditional CGI does, 3DGS represents a space using millions of tiny colored blobs, or “gaussians,” that together produce photo-realistic environments you can actually navigate through in real time. XGrids has been building its entire product stack around this technology, and the two products at IFA represent opposite ends of the same pipeline. The PortalCam is billed as the first handheld device that captures reality as interactive 3D environments using 3DGS technology, combining LiDAR, a four-camera array, and automated processing to create photorealistic spatial models you can walk through, edit, and share across platforms. At under 900 grams, it can scan 100 square metres in 10 minutes at walking speed. The LiDAR system fires 856,000 points per second across a 180-degree azimuth by 180-degree elevation field of view, while the four-camera array pairs two fisheye lenses with two front-facing cameras, each fisheye covering 200 degrees. That’s a lot of spatial data coming in very fast, from a device you can carry in a backpack.

The Lixel CyberColor platform, or LCC, is where all that captured data becomes something usable. It combines Multi-SLAM precision with optimized 3D Gaussian Splatting to create measurement-grade, photorealistic, lightweight 3D models, bridging the gap between technical accuracy and immersive visualization for professionals across industries. The compression story is particularly worth noting: a breakthrough 90% compression technology dramatically reduces file sizes without compromising quality, enabling smooth playback on cloud, edge, and mobile. That solves the problem that has always made spatial content impractical outside of specialized production environments, the files are simply too large to move around and too heavy to stream. Ready-made integration with Unity, Unreal Engine, WebGL via Cesium and Three.js, mobile apps, and XR applications means the output plugs directly into workflows that architects, game developers, and filmmakers are already using. And then there’s the surprise announcement at the show: LCC Scan, a new iOS application that enables users to transform ordinary photos and videos into detailed 3DGS models directly on their iPhones. The professional pipeline and the consumer entry point, both at IFA, in the same week. That’s a confident move.

OCJOY Air-Streaming Oral Cleaner: The Dental Clinic Protocol That Now Lives on Your Bathroom Counter

Plaque gets all the marketing attention in oral care, but the real problem is biofilm, the structured bacterial colony that anchors to enamel, builds a protective shield, and starts rebuilding within hours of brushing. Bristles only clean where they make contact, leaving grooves, pits, and gumline areas routinely untouched. Water flossers reach the gaps but carry no active cleaning agent. OCJOY’s answer is Air-Streaming Technology, built on Guided Biofilm Therapy (GBT), a Swiss clinical protocol designed to gently lift biofilm using precisely controlled air, water, and fine food-grade powder. Until now, GBT has been available only in dental practices; OCJOY makes it practical for daily use, delivering a clean that bristles or water alone cannot achieve. The proprietary TriMatter system propels millions of fine particles across enamel surfaces and into grooves, pits, and interdental gaps, disrupting biofilm exactly where water flossers cannot reach.

Independent lab testing puts numbers behind those claims. In 20 seconds, OCJOY removed 99.9% of biofilm, compared to 9.2% left behind by an electric toothbrush under the same conditions. Surface stains from coffee, tea, wine, and tobacco cleared at 88% to 100% without bleach, and a 100-participant study recorded visible whitening of 2-3 shades within 3-7 days. Traditional oral care demands four separate tools, a water flosser, toothbrush, dental polisher, and mouthwash, taking up to 15 minutes for a thorough clean; OCJOY consolidates all of that into a single device in approximately three minutes. The powder chamber holds enough for about 20 uses, the 150mL magnetic water tank lifts out, refills, and snaps back in seconds, and a single tap triggers an automatic self-cleaning cycle that blows out residual moisture and flushes internal pathways to prevent clogs. Clinicians from USC, Shanghai Jiao Tong University School of Medicine, and West China Hospital of Stomatology have evaluated the technology and recommend it for daily cleaning between professional visits.

KEENON Humanoid Pours Drinks at GCS 2026, 100,000 Others Run Hotels

The robotics industry has a curious reputation problem. The machines getting the most attention, walking bipeds that do backflips, aren’t the ones driving real business value. By 2030, professional service robots are projected to account for $90 billion of a $161 billion global market, growing at 24.6% annually. That makes them the fastest-growing segment in robotics, which is a fact that barely makes the news.

KEENON Robotics has known this for a while. Founded in 2010, the Shanghai-based company didn’t wait for the hype cycle; it built the service delivery robot category from the ground up. Today, with over 100,000 units shipped across more than 60 countries, KEENON holds the number-one global market share in commercial service robots for the third consecutive year, according to IDC 2025.

Designer: KEENON Robotics

At Global Connect Show 2026, the star of KEENON’s booth was the XMAN-R1, a wheeled humanoid robot that makes popcorn, pours drinks, and hands out snacks. It’s the kind of demo that stops foot traffic, and it’s meant to. Underneath the theatrics, though, is a robot packing 275 TOPS of AI processing power, dual 7-DoF arms, and precision dexterous hands built for human-level manipulation.

What the demo doesn’t show is how much work went into teaching a robot to grab a cup. KEENON estimates that a single action of that kind requires at least 1,000 data points. A full coffee-making sequence demands over 20,000. That gap between what looks effortless and what it actually costs computationally is one of the clearest explanations of where physical AI sits right now.

KEENON is remarkably candid about this. Their own assessment puts the current “mind age” of humanoid robots at roughly three years old, which, if you think about it, explains a lot about why they move so deliberately. True general-purpose humanoid deployment is still at least five years out by their estimation. The “Model T” framing they use is apt; these are early machines, not finished ones.

That candor is also what makes KEENON’s established product line feel more credible. While the XMAN-R1 gets the headlines, KEENON’s delivery and cleaning robots have been running inside hotels, restaurants, hospitals, airports, and casinos across more than 600 cities globally. Their DINERBOT T10 can carry up to 40 kg, fits through a 59 cm passage, and operates for up to eight hours on a single charge.

A good example of what that looks like in practice is Shangri-La Hong Kong, where KEENON runs six different robot types across eight units within a single hotel. Delivery bots handle contactless room service; cleaning robots run scheduled cycles through lobbies and corridors; logistics carriers shuttle linens and supplies behind the scenes. None of this required the hotel to restructure its operations around the robots.

Part of why that integration works comes down to a deliberate design choice. KEENON chose not to make its service robots look human. The compact, rounded bodies, soft voices, and animated screen faces are intentional, because how a robot looks determines whether people trust it. Western audiences carry Terminator-shaped anxieties; Asian audiences grew up with characters like Doraemon. The design has to work for both.

The XMAN-R1 at the Global Connect Show is KEENON’s way of signaling where the product line is heading. Alongside it, the company also offers the bipedal XMAN-F1, a full-body humanoid with 43 degrees of freedom that takes the same task-driven approach. Both run on KEENON’s KOM 2.0 platform and are designed to work alongside existing robots like the DINERBOT T10 rather than replace them.

What KEENON actually has over the wave of humanoid startups entering the market is something harder to replicate than a robot body. With 100,000 units running across 70+ countries, the company has been accumulating proprietary operational data at a scale most competitors haven’t even started to approach. Every delivery, every corridor, every cup poured feeds back into that picture, one data point at a time.

ZenoWell: Vagus Nerve Stimulation for Stress and Sleep

Most wearables track what your body is doing; ZenoWell claims to actively change it by stimulating the vagus nerve through your ear. The company uses transcutaneous auricular vagus nerve stimulation (taVNS) technology, targeting the only branch of the vagus nerve located on the body’s surface with electrical pulses designed to enhance parasympathetic activity, restore balance to the autonomic nervous system, and modulate brain activity and neurotransmitters. Founded in Heidelberg, Germany with engineering in Shenzhen, China, ZenoWell positions itself as wearable neurotech that activates the body’s natural healing power rather than relying on medication or quick fixes. The science backs some of this; a 2024 JAMA Network Open study showed eight weeks of taVNS use resulted in significant clinical improvement for chronic insomnia, outperforming control groups in reducing anxiety, depression, and fatigue, with effects lasting up to 20 weeks and demonstrating good safety and high patient compliance.

ZenoWell has two main devices: Luna and Vita, both offering 100% vagus nerve coverage through ergonomically designed earpieces. Luna includes an enhanced Relief Mode targeting headaches for both acute episodes and long-term prevention, along with modes for relaxation, sleep improvement, fatigue reduction, inflammation management, and body pain relief. Vita focuses on faster sleep onset with 20-minute sessions, deep relaxation, and body-mind balance restoration, claiming better sleep, less fatigue, and reduced body pain within seven days. Both devices offer multiple modes: Sleep Mode for insomnia and sleep disturbance, Relax Mode for stress and anxiety, Medit Mode for body pain and inflammation, and Relief Mode for headaches including migraines and cluster headaches. The system requires consistent use; most benefits appear after two to four weeks, with full effects observable after 24 weeks depending on the condition being addressed. Whether strapping a nerve stimulator to your ear feels like self-care or medical intervention probably depends on your tolerance for wellness technology that requires daily commitment, but for people exhausted by sleep medications or chronic stress who want alternatives beyond meditation apps, ZenoWell offers a science-backed approach with published clinical results instead of just marketing promises.

Ascentiz BodyOS: Hip and Knee Modules

Ascentiz’s BodyOS platform takes a modular approach to human augmentation, letting users swap joint actuators depending on whether they’re climbing mountains, working construction sites, or just need help with mobility. At Global Connect, the company is demonstrating two core modules: a hip actuator that delivers 36 Nm of torque through a quasi-direct-drive system, and a knee actuator using cable-drive transmission to hit 48 Nm while keeping heavy motors away from the moving limb. The hip module can assist at speeds up to 28 km/h and reduces leg effort by 35% on inclines, while the knee module claims to cut knee joint pressure by 50% and reduce energy waste by 30%. Both modules attach to a T700 aerospace carbon fiber frame that can handle temperatures from -20°C to 60°C, making this a system designed for actual outdoor conditions rather than controlled laboratory demonstrations.

The intelligence behind these modules comes from what Ascentiz calls its “Motion Cortex,” an AI trained on over 690,000 musculoskeletal gait cycles that processes data from more than 10 sensors to recognize seven different motion scenarios with 99.5% accuracy. The system responds in under 500 milliseconds when it detects a change in movement pattern, with actuator transitions happening in under 200 milliseconds. Users can strap the entire system on in less than 10 seconds using a proprietary ETIE dial mechanism, which addresses one of the persistent complaints about exoskeletons: that they take too long to put on and adjust. The control loop runs at 20 microseconds, fast enough to respond to the unpredictable shifts in terrain and body position that define real-world hiking, climbing, or industrial work. This isn’t augmentation for the sake of looking futuristic; it’s engineering focused on whether someone’s knees will hold up after a 10-mile trek with a heavy pack.
